The Desert Boot
Since 1950
Designed by Nathan Clark in 1950, the Desert Boot revolutionized casual footwear with its clean lines and crepe sole, becoming a global icon.
The Wallabee
Since 1968
Introduced in 1968, the Clarks Wallabee redefined casual style with its moccasin-inspired shape and clean silhouette. It’s a timeless icon that moves with culture.
The Desert Trek
Since 1972
Designed by Lance Clark in 1972, the Clarks Desert Trek stands out with its central seam, Trek Man heel, and foot-shaped fit. A shoe for those who move differently.
